Vice President Delcy Rodríguez held a meeting with representatives of the European Union

The meeting seeks to advance the restoration of political relations between nations

The Executive Vice President of the Republic, Delcy Rodríguez, held a meeting with heads of mission of European Union (EU) countries, in Caracas, to advance the restoration of political relations between nations and to review the cooperation map of the joint agenda.

In the account of the social network X, of the Executive Vice Presidency of the Republic, he points out that the purpose of this meeting is for “the #UE to receive, firsthand, official information on the Venezuelan context in the political, economic, social and electoral spheres, within the framework of the Barbados Agreement”.

He adds that the meeting is being held on the occasion of an agenda of activities carried out by these European diplomats in the country and that it began this Wednesday, 24, at the Casa Amarilla Antonio José de Sucre, headquarters of the Venezuelan Foreign Ministry.

In a report by Venezolana de Televisión, she points out that this meeting is attended by plenipotentiary ambassadors, business managers and diplomatic representatives resident and non-resident in the country, who are part of EU countries.

This will also allow the Venezuelan authorities to present official information in various areas related to politics, economic, social and electoral, respectively.
